Keziah CROXFORD was born to John and Wilmot (FOSTER) CROXFORD in 1785 in Limerick, York Co, Maine.
On January 16, 1801, she married John FENDERSON, son of William and Anna (MCKINNEY) FENDERSON. Together, they are known to be the parents of 12 children.
At some point Keziah became known as Dolly FENDERSON (hence this name on her marker).
Keziah 'Dolly' (CROXFORD) FENDERSON died on June 19, 1854 in Owego, N.Y.

Keziah is listed in multiple Fenderson family histories and in:

- Eben Dunham Wiswell Jr, editor, Fifteen Generations of Americans 1620-1986: Including Many of the Family Lines that Lead to the Fifteenth Generation. (Middlebury Center, PA: E.D. Wiswell, 1986.)

- William Richard Cutter A.M., editor, Genealogical and Family History of Western New York, Volume III (New York, New York: Lewis Historical Publishing Company, 1912.)
